Possum Magic
Monkey Baa Theatre Company brings the magical story of ‘Possum Magic’ to life on stage, adapted from the beloved Australian picture book by Mem Fox and Julie Vivas. The production uses live action, stage magic, original soundscape, puppetry, and projected animation to create a whimsical world for audiences aged 3-8 years and their families. The story follows Grandma Poss, who makes Hush invisible to protect her from danger but then can’t find the spell to make her visible again. The journey to find the special food that will make Hush visible takes them on an adventure to cities around Australia.

Other things to do on the Coffs Coast
Go for a swim or have a picnic at the beautiful beaches in Coffs Harbour, such as Jetty Beach, Park Beach, and Diggers Beach.
Explore the Solitary Islands Marine Park by joining a snorkeling or diving trip.
Go on a whale watching tour and see majestic humpback whales up close.
Take a scenic drive to Dorrigo National Park and enjoy the stunning views of waterfalls, rainforests, and wildlife.
Go on a fishing trip, either on a charter boat or on one of the many fishing spots along the coast
